What is Hamlet’s last request as expressed to Horatio?
What is Hamlet’s dying request of Horatio? Hamlet wants Horatio to tell his life story, and
to tell Fortinbras that he gives permission for him to become the next king of Denmark
. As he dies, Hamlet says that young Fortinbras has his vote to the next ruler of Denmark.
What is the last line of Hamlet?
Meaning of Hamlet’s Last Words
” In Hamlet’s last short speech, he makes arrangements for the future of Denmark, of which he is the dying king. He then breaks off short. His last line in the play is
”Which have solicited – The rest is silence
. ”

Why did Gertrude drink the poison?
In Laurence Olivier’s film adaptation of Hamlet, Gertrude drinks
knowingly, presumably to save her son from certain death
. If she drinks on purpose, then she’s the self-sacrificing mother Hamlet has always wanted her to be.
Does Claudius really love Gertrude?
Claudius’s love for Gertrude may be sincere
, but it also seems likely that he married her as a strategic move, to help him win the throne away from Hamlet after the death of the king. …

What is the main cause of death in the play Hamlet?
In Shakespeare’s Hamlet, the deaths of all of the characters you mention are the result of
Claudius’ murderous conniving
. Claudius talks Laertes into killing Hamlet to avenge Polonius’ death.
What is the irony of Gertrude’s death?
Gertrude’s death shows dramatic irony,
as she is caught up in a trap set by her husband to catch her son
. And Hamlet, who is just coming into his own, suggests that death is inevitable and truly waits for no man.
What famous line does Horatio deliver at the end of the play?
‘Now cracks a noble heart
‘ is the appropriately heartbreaking comment on Hamlet’s death at the end of Shakespeare’s Hamlet. The line is delivered by Hamlet’s best – his only – friend, Horatio.

What is Hamlet’s tragic flaw?
The word ‘tragic flaw’ is taken from the Greek concept of Hamartia used by Greek philosopher Aristotle in his Poetics. Shakespeare’s tragic hero Hamlet’s fatal flaw is his failure to act immediately to kill Claudius, his uncle and murderer of his father. His tragic flaw is ‘
procrastination
‘.
